Soca Royale semi-finalists announced

COME JULY 7 the Kensington Oval will be bursting at the seams with entertainment as three consecutive competitions will take place for Phenomenal Friday, now in its second year.

On Sunday evening National Cultural Foundation’s Corporate Communications Specialist Simone Codrington announced the 32 semi-finalists and the reserves of the much-anticipated Soca Royale competitions at the NCF’s headquarters.

Seeking to dethrone 2016 Sweet Soca king Edwin Yearwood are: Damian Marvay – Antidote; Fadda Fox – Good Ole Days; Faith – Refill; Kirk Brown – Incredible Girl; Lil Rick – Blessing; Marzville – Give it to Ya; Mistah Dale – De Ting Start; Mr. Blood – Look Fuh Meh; Natahlee – Neva Let Ugo; Nikita – Carry festival; RPB – Boat Ride; Sanctuary– Pick Me UP; Shaquille – Collateral; Shirley Stewart – I cant Help It; Statement –We Nah Leavin’; and TC with Paradise. The reserve is Mikey with Level Up.

The semi-finalists for the Party Monarch competition who will come up against reigning king Lil Rick are: Faith – Run It; Gorg- If Ah Drunk Ah Drunk; Holla Bak- Hold De Key; Jahm-r – Make a Wave; Kirk Brown – Shake; Mikey – Feting and Brass; Mistah Dale – Soca Famaleez; Mr. Blood – Leggo; Nik-Man- Whinning Tusty; Peter Ram – Upside Down; Queen T – Enchanted; Rameses – Fowl Cock; Ras Iley & Grynner – D 2 ah We; Saffiyah – Tun Up; Scribz – Waistline Tekova; and Sim Simma with Professional Gals. The reserve was named as Leadpipe & Saddis with their contribution called Hose it, but the duo will concede their reserve spot.

The winner-takes-all Yello-Bashment Soca finals will see Coopa Dan & Rhea, Hardware, Lady Essence, Marzville, Scrilla and Snap Brandy come up against reigning Bashment King Stiffy for the grand prize of
$50 000.
